Decoding Scott Bakula's Height: The Official Stats

Okay, let's get straight to the point. Scott Bakula's height is officially listed as 5 feet 10 inches (178 cm). This puts him at a pretty average height for men in the United States, which might surprise some of you who see him commanding the screen. Scott Bakula's Height Compared: Co-stars and Beyond

Alright, guys, let's dive into some fun comparisons! How does Scott Bakula's height stack up against his co-stars and other famous actors? This is where things get interesting because seeing him alongside others can give us a better sense of his stature. For instance, let's take a look at his Star Trek: Enterprise days. His co-star, Connor Trinneer (who played Trip Tucker), is listed as 6 feet tall. When you see them together on screen, the height difference is noticeable, but it's not drastic. Bakula's 5'10" doesn't make him appear significantly shorter, which is a testament to his commanding presence and the way he carries himself.

Then there's Dean Stockwell, his co-star in Quantum Leap. Stockwell was reportedly around 5'8", making Bakula slightly taller. This dynamic worked well for their on-screen relationship, where Bakula's character, Sam Beckett, often took the lead. The subtle height difference contributed to the visual portrayal of their dynamic. It's fascinating how these small details can add to the overall storytelling.

Another interesting aspect to consider is how camera angles and set design can influence our perception of height. Directors and cinematographers are masters of illusion, using various techniques to create a desired effect. For example, placing a shorter actor on a slightly raised platform or using upward camera angles can make them appear taller. Conversely, downward angles can make someone seem shorter. These are subtle tricks of the trade that can impact how we perceive an actor's height on screen.
